And while Les Miles had good things to say about his two returning quarterbacks — Anthony Jennings and Brandon Harris — on his ESPN tour Monday, he also said he would have been interested in one of those graduate transfer QBs.
quote:
His confidence in QBs Anthony Jennings and Brandon Harris: I like both guys. They're both improved. We started with no experience and now these guys have developed and understand how to snap-cadence and function the offense. They're much better. So we're looking forward to the fall.
